Hey everyone,
I just received my on-road assistance kit and first aid kit from the dealer today and wanted to share them in case anyone else is looking to buy them. They were actually an add-on from the dealer that were itemized on my window sticker. I encourage everyone to look at their window stickers because the dealer didn’t inform me of this, in fact, they didn’t exist at the time I purchased my car (in May). To be honest, I originally wanted my money back since I paid for them, but I am shocked at how nice these kits are. The on-road kit has a lot of good essentials that you might need in a light emergency situation or to make quick repairs- and it's great quality too! They are branded with the Bronco logo and the First Aid Kit has the ability to be strapped to the MOLLE straps. Going to attach some pictures to this post as well.
